Python port of Anders and Briegel’ s method for fast simulation of Clifford circuits.
import abp
from abp.util import xyz
g = abp.GraphState()
g.add_qubit("alice", position=xyz(0, 0, 0))
g.add_qubit("bob", position=xyz(0, 0, 0))
g.act_hadamard("alice")
g.act_hadamard("bob")
g.act_cz("alice", "bob")
g.push() # Sends for visualization
Install from source
$ git clone http://gitlab.psiquantum.lan/pete/abp
$ cd abp
$ virtualenv env
$ source env/bin/activate
$ python setup.py develop
